As the number of political science professionals in Norman has grown, salaries for political science professionals have also increased. In 2010 an average salary of $47,580 per year was earned by political science professionals in Norman. Political science professionals in Norman made a yearly average salary of $42,620, four years earlier in 2006. The growth in the salary of political science professionals in Norman is slower than the salary trend for all careers in the city.

Political science professionals in Norman earn a median salary of $47,890 per year. The 10% of political science professionals in the lowest pay bracket earn less than $25,210 per year, while those in the highest pay bracket earn approximately $76,100 per year.
